Proper noun[edit]
Linz
- The capital of, and largest city in, the state of Upper Austria, Austria, and the third-largest city in the country.
- A small town in northern Rhineland-Palatinate, Germany, a popular tourist destination along the Rhine.

Proper noun[edit]
Linz n (proper noun, strong, genitive Linz' or Linzens or (with an article) Linz)
- Linz (a city in Upper Austria, Austria)
- Synonym: Linz in Österreich
- Linz (a town in Rhineland-Palatinate, Germany)
- Synonym: Linz am Rhein
